About Circuit Zandvoort

Zandvoort held Dutch Grands Prix from 1952 to 1985, disappeared from the calendar for 35 years, and returned in 2021 with a layout rebuilt specifically to make modern Formula 1 cars race. Cut into the dunes on the North Sea coast, it is narrow, undulating and unusually short on run-off by contemporary standards.

Its distinguishing feature is banking. Turn three and the final corner, Arie Luyendyk, are both banked — the latter at 18 degrees, the steepest corner in Formula 1. The banked final turn allows cars to run side by side and carry more speed onto the start-finish straight, which was the explicit purpose of the redesign.

The seaside location brings two complications. Sand blows onto the circuit and reduces grip off-line, and the wind coming off the North Sea changes direction through the day, altering braking points on a lap that already offers very little margin.

Notable facts

  • The banked final corner, Arie Luyendyk, is inclined at 18 degrees — the steepest corner in Formula 1.
  • Returned to the calendar in 2021 after a 35-year absence, the longest gap for any circuit that has come back.
  • Max Verstappen won the first three Dutch Grands Prix after the circuit's return.
  • Wind-blown sand from the surrounding dunes measurably reduces grip off the racing line.
